Por que utmp, wtmp e btmp são chamados como são?

9

Sei o que esses arquivos registram, mas gostaria de saber o que significam os prefixos 'u', 'w', 'b'.

Alguém pode lançar alguma luz?

sgx1
fonte

Respostas:

12

O 'u' significa usuário. utmpfornece informações sobre quem está no sistema.
O 'w' wtmpprovavelmente vem de 'quem'.
O 'b' vem de 'ruim', btmpregistra as tentativas incorretas de login.

Os nomes são um pouco enigmáticos, como tantas vezes no Unix / Linux.

Anthon
fonte
1
E a parte tmp é para 'temp'? Estou perguntando seriamente.
Bitofagoob 29/05
2
Não faço ideia, procurei um pouco, mas não consegui encontrar nada. utmpé claro que tem informações fugazes, temporárias e foi o arquivo inicial disponível, mas não tenho confirmação de que essa possa ser a origem dessa parte do nome. Você deve postar isso como uma nova pergunta.
Anthon